A tsunami can occur when there is vertical movement at a fault under?

A tsunami can occur when there is vertical movement at a fault under the ocean floor, displacing a large volume of water. This displacement generates a series of powerful waves that can travel long distances across the ocean. When these waves reach shallow coastal areas, they can increase in height and cause devastating flooding and destruction.

Are there more earthquakes under the sea than on land?

Yes, there are more earthquakes under the sea than on land because the majority of Earth's tectonic plate boundaries are located beneath the ocean. These plate boundaries are where most earthquakes occur due to the movement of the plates.


Can earthquakes happen under water?

Yes, earthquakes can happen underwater. When an earthquake occurs beneath the ocean, it can cause a tsunami if the magnitude is strong enough to displace a significant amount of water. Underwater earthquakes are monitored by seismologists to assess the potential risk of tsunamis.

Can water freeze instantly under certain conditions?

Yes, water can freeze instantly under certain conditions, such as when it is supercooled below its freezing point without any disturbance or nucleation sites to initiate the freezing process.
